2. Philly Transit Plan

A Philadelphia World Cup transit plan will offer free rides home on SEPTA's B line after all six matches in the city, backed by Airbnb. According to the local organizers cited in the post, the idea is to make postmatch travel easier for fans leaving the stadium and to reduce some of the usual chaos around major events.

3. Croatia Recognition Debate

Croatia is being treated like a second-tier World Cup brand even though the national team has stacked up deep runs and major results. The post argues that Croatian fans can find praise online but not much real-world recognition, especially when it comes to merchandise, shop space, and kit design despite semifinal and final appearances in recent tournaments.
